313.15(a)(3),313.15(a)(1)
On 9/23/2024 at approximately 1718 hours on the slaughter floor . while performing HATS category. I CSI REDACTED and SPHV REDACTED observed a stunning noncompliance at establishment M11111. Taking two stunning attempts to render a hog unconscious. The first stun appeared to enter around center mass but 1.5 inches to high, leaving the hog still conscious and moving. Hog was not vocalizing at that moment. Employee “REDACTED took immediate action by following up with a quick stun rendering the animal unconscious. A regulatory control action was taken stopping slaughter production. On Postmortem inspection the head was observed and the SPHV and CSI noted that there were two distinct points of contact on the head of the hog. The initial stun entered in the top of the head area of the hog. The second point of contact was correctly placed on the hog. Slaughter personnel REDACTED Processing personnel REDACTED and Owner REDACTED was notified of the non-compliance. Slaughter process was restored with authorization from supervisor.
313.15(a)(1)
On 7/15/2024 at approximately 1700 hours on the slaughter. while performing HATS category. I CSI REDACTED and FLS REDACTED observed a stunning noncompliance at establishment M11111. Taking two stunning attempts to render a hog unconscious. The first stun appeared to enter around the right eye, leaving the hog still conscious and moving. Hog was not vocalizing at that moment. Employee “Bo Ford” took immediate action by following up with a quick stun rendering the animal unconscious. A regulatory control action was taken stopping slaughter production. On Postmortem inspection the head was skinned and the FLS and CSI noted that there were two distinct points of contact on the head of the hog. The initial stun entered in the right eye socket of the hog. The second point of contact was correctly placed on the hog. Slaughter personnel REDACTED Processing personnel REDACTED and Owner REDACTED was notified of the non-compliance. Slaughter process was restored with authorization from supervisor.
